The Mechanics of Luxury Real Estate: Understanding the Market
So, what drives the luxury real estate market? Several factors contribute to its success:
- Unparalleled amenities: Luxury properties often feature cutting-edge architectural designs, private pools, home theaters, and access to exclusive clubhouses and community spaces.
- Prime locations: Properties are often situated in upscale neighborhoods, offering proximity to top-rated schools, world-class shopping, and exclusive dining experiences.
- Customization and unique features: Luxury buyers are willing to pay a premium for bespoke properties, complete with custom designs, high-end finishes, and unique architectural elements.
- Exclusivity and prestige: The luxury real estate market is characterized by its rarity and exclusivity, with properties often sold to the highest bidder or through exclusive networking channels.

Luxury Real Estate for Different Users
Luxury real estate caters to a diverse range of buyers, each with unique needs and preferences. Some of the most common users of the luxury market include:
- Billionaires and ultra-high-net-worth individuals: These buyers are drawn to exclusive, one-of-a-kind properties that reflect their status and wealth.
- Retail investors: Investors often seek luxury properties as a tangible asset, providing a hedge against market volatility and a potential source of passive income.
- High-income professionals: Successful business leaders, entrepreneurs, and executives are increasingly entering the luxury market, seeking to upgrade their lifestyle and demonstrate their success.
- Foreign buyers: Non-domestic buyers are becoming increasingly prominent in the luxury market, attracted to the anonymity, security, and prestige that comes with owning a high-end property abroad.
